Nov 12, 2010 (newstodate): EU already publishes regularly updated airline blacklist naming carriers banned from its airports due to slack safety standards. Now a similar blacklist on airports may be on the table.
The initiative for a list of airports around the world not adhering to EU security standards as to airfreight security has been taken by the German minister of the interior, and a five-point proposal has been delivered for consideration by EU's interior ministers at a forthcoming meeting.
A decision on whether to carry forward the proposal is expected to be reached on December 2, 2010.
